Summary
The unicode character "㛌" at code point U+36CC is CJK Unified Ideograph-#. It is a character in the CJK Unified Ideographs Extension A block and is part of the Han script. The character is an other letter. The UTF-8 encoding of "㛌" is 0xE3 0x9B 0x8C and the UTF-16 encoding is 0x36CC.
